From 2e7b9058d0dc60919c629f84e37f2ecd0ef508f8 Mon Sep 17 00:00:00 2001 From: Christoph Wickert Date: Thu, 22 Apr 2010 11:03:47 +0200 Subject: Security: sync with LXDE --- fedora-livecd-security.ks | 44 ++++++++++++++++++++++++++------------------ 1 file changed, 26 insertions(+), 18 deletions(-) diff --git a/fedora-livecd-security.ks b/fedora-livecd-security.ks index 9bbc4f3..3ef6c9e 100644 --- a/fedora-livecd-security.ks +++ b/fedora-livecd-security.ks @@ -16,38 +16,40 @@ %include fedora-live-minimization.ks %packages -security-menus +# internet firefox -yum-presto -midori -cups-pdf -gnome-bluetooth -alsa-plugins-pulseaudio -pavucontrol +claws-mail + # Command line +cnetworkmanager +irssi +mutt ntfs-3g powertop wget -irssi -mutt yum-utils -cnetworkmanager -Thunar -gtk-xfce-engine -thunar-volman -xarchiver +yum-presto # dictionaries are big #-aspell-* +#-hunspell-* #-man-pages-* +#-words # more fun with space saving -gimp-help #GUI Stuff @lxde +Thunar +thunar-volman +xarchiver +gnome-bluetooth +alsa-plugins-pulseaudio +pavucontrol +system-config-printer # save some space -autofs @@ -55,11 +57,10 @@ xarchiver -sendmail ssmtp -acpid -# system-config-printer does printer management better -# xfprint has now been made as optional in comps. -system-config-printer ###################### Security Stuffs ############################ +security-menus + # Reconnaissance dsniff hping3 @@ -184,10 +185,17 @@ cat >> /etc/rc.d/init.d/livesys << EOF cat > /etc/xdg/lxsession/LXDE/autostart << FOE /usr/libexec/gam_server @lxpanel --profile LXDE -@pcmanfm -d +@pcmanfm2 --desktop --profile lxde @pulseaudio -D FOE +# set up preferred apps +cat > /etc/xdg/libfm/pref-apps.conf << FOE +[Preferred Applications] +WebBrowser=mozilla-firefox.desktop +MailClient=fedora-claws-mail.desktop +FOE + # set up auto-login for liveuser sed -i 's|# autologin=dgod|autologin=liveuser|g' /etc/lxdm/lxdm.conf -- cgit